Parental Guidelines

1. Make sure to keep more gruesome aspects of media from children, such as in movies or games. These can have harmful effects on child development. (Do not buy Gears of War).

2. As kids mature, make efforts to befriend them and learn what types of media they like to use on a regular basis. With this knowledge you can better monitor their media activities.

3. Older kids or young adults should not be subject to as much restrictions. Specifically, ages 15 and up should very few restrictions on media use. For internet, however, make sure to emphasize the lack of privacy and the dangers inherent in online activity to them.

4. Make some effort to reduce the passive media consumption of kids, as it can reduce their productivity and academic effort. (Possibly limit to 2.5 hrs a day). Do not be a tyrant, though, as it can breed resentment and rebellion.
